Warning Signs You Need Wet Vacuum Water Extraction

Don’t wait until it’s too late to address water damage in your property. Early detection is key to preventing further damage and costly repairs. Here are some common warning signs that you need wet vacuum water extraction: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strange smells can be a sign of underlying water damage. Don’t ignore the warning signs. If you notice persistent musty odors in your property, it’s time to call our team for an assessment.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Water damage can cause floors to become warped or buckled. Don’t delay. If you notice any changes in your flooring, our team is here to help.

Visible Stains or Discoloration

Visible stains or discoloration on your wal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of water damage. Don’t wait. If you notice any unusual stains or discoloration, our team is here to help.

Water Stains on the Ceiling

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leaky roof or pipe. Don’t ignore the warning signs. If you notice water stains on your ceiling, our team is here to help.

Water Damage on Your Walls

Water damage on your walls can be a sign of a leaky pipe or water source. Don’t wait. If you notice any signs of water damage on your walls, our team is here to help.

Water Damage on Your Ceiling

Water damage on your ceiling can be a sign of a leaky roof or pipe. Don’t ignore the warning signs. If you notice water damage on your ceiling, our team is here to help.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Cost in Greenwich, NY

The cost of wet vacuum water extraction can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team will provide you with a free estimate and guide you through the process. Don’t let cost be a barrier to restoring your property to its original condition.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ed
Cleaning and Disinfecting $100 – $500 Size of affected area and type of surfaces affected
Final Inspection and Completion $100 – $500 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ed

Exact pricing will depend on the specifics of your situation and an on-site assessment. Our team will provide you with a free estimate and guide you through the process. Don’t let cost be a barrier to restoring your property to its original condition.

Q: What is the difference between wet vacuum water extraction and drying?

A: Wet vacuum water extraction is the process of removing standing water from a flooded property, while drying is the process of removing any remaining moisture from the property.
